宝塔调用python(宝塔+Python:轻松搭建高效服务器,快速提升网站性能)

摘要: 现代的网络环境下,快速、高效能能的服务器是普及的必要条件。而如何实现服务器的高效能能和快速呢?本文将介绍通过使用宝塔+Python来轻松搭建高效能能服务器,快速提升网站性能的方法,帮助读者更好地理解这个领域的知识。一、宝塔:方便快捷的服务器管理工具1、什么是宝塔?宝塔是一款集成各种服务器服务于一身的软件管理工具,可以实现 Linux 服务器的快速配置,...

摘要:现代的网络环境下,快速、高效能能的服务器是普及的必要条件。而如何实现服务器的高效能能和快速呢?本文将介绍通过使用宝塔+Python来轻松搭建高效能能服务器,快速提升网站性能的方法,帮助读者更好地理解这个领域的知识。

一、宝塔:方便快捷的服务器管理工具

1、什么是宝塔?

宝塔是一款集成各种服务器服务于一身的软件管理工具,可以实现 Linux 服务器的快速配置,同时也支持 Windows 服务器的配置。它可以让您管理您的服务器,轻松安装所需要的软件,可以完成如备份、数据恢复、网站建立等多项服务。

2、为什么选择宝塔?

相对于传统的命令行操作,使用宝塔可以让我们省去许多繁琐的操作步骤,提高工作效率。此外,由于宝塔集成了各种功能性插件,安装插件也很方便,使得用户可以在不熟悉命令行的情况下完成服务器的配置与管理。

3、如何使用宝塔搭建服务器?

宝塔调用python(宝塔+Python:轻松搭建高效服务器,快速提升网站性能)

搭建服务器需要购买虚拟机或者云服务器,选购适合自己的机器后,可以通过宝塔的图形界面来完成环境的配置。您只需进行简单的操作,就可以完成 LAMP、LNMP、Tomcat、Java 等多种类型的服务环境搭建。

二、Python:快速提升网站性能的利器

1、什么是 Python?

Python 是一种面向对象的高级编程语言,它易于理解、学习和阅读,并且具有很好的代码可读性。它的语法简单明了,同时可以快速进行开发,是目前广泛使用的编程语言之一。网站性能的提升,Python 编程的技术是其中必不可少的一种。

2、Python 可以如何提升网站性能?

基于 Python 的框架 Django,可以帮助您快速地搭建一个高效能能友好的 Web 网站,同时,它的 ORM (Object Relational Mapping)也是一个十分高效能能的数据库操作技术,可以大大提高数据库的读写效率。

3、如何搭建 Python 的 Web 服务?

您可以使用 Python 的 WSGI 协议来完成 Web 服务器的部署。使用 Apache 和 Nginx 配合 Python WSGI,您可以轻松地搭建出一个高效能能的 Web 服务。

三、优化服务器性能提升网站的响应速度

1、如何提高网站的响应速度?

对于需要处理大量请求的高访问量网站,我们需要考虑提高网站的并发处理能力和性能优化。可以使用负载均衡,避免某些服务的过载,同时可以缓存静态资源,如 Web 站点上的 CSS、JS、图片等。利用反向代理将请求转发到缓存服务器,可以提高网站的响应速度。

2、如何配置负载均衡?

宝塔调用python(宝塔+Python:轻松搭建高效服务器,快速提升网站性能)

使用 Nginx 可以非常方便地进行负载均衡配置。只需要在 nginx.conf 中添加负载均衡配置信息,即可完成负载均衡的部署。

3、如何配置缓存静态资源?

使用 nginx 缓存静态文件,可以有效降低服务器和后端资源的消耗。可以在 nginx 配置文件中添加如下指令来缓存静态资源:

宝塔调用python(宝塔+Python:轻松搭建高效服务器,快速提升网站性能)

location ~* \.(gif|jpg|jpeg|png|bmp|swf|css|js)$ {

    expires 1d;

    root /var/www;

}

四、无风险性提升

1、对于服务器的无风险性需要怎样进行提升?

对于一个 Web 服务器,开放的端口与服务过多会使得服务器的无风险性大大下降。因此,我们需要使用一些无风险的手段来提高服务器的无风险性,可以使用 SSL 证书加密传输或者进行密码保护。

2、如何获取 SSL 证书并进行配置?

SSL 证书可以在 CA 数字证书公司(如 LetsEncrypt)中获取。使用 acme.sh 工具可以方便地申请证书和进行自动更新。在 nginx 服务器中,可以通过添加如下指令来启用 SSL:

listen 443 ssl; # 开启 SSL

ssl_certificate <path to cert>; # SSL 证书

ssl_certificate_key <path to key>; # SSL 证书的 key

五、总结:

本文介绍了如何使用宝塔+Python来轻松搭建高效能能服务器,快速提升网站性能,使 Web 服务器运行更加高效能能流畅。我们可以通过搭建服务器、使用 Python 编程、优化服务器性能和提高服务器无风险性等手段来提高我们的 Web 服务器质量。如果您有任何与 Python 相关的技术问题,欢迎添加交流。

广告语:Python 初学者群:xxxxxx,欢迎大家加入交流。

本文链接:https://www.aiqan.com/jiaoben/99369.html

版权声明:如非注明,本站所有文章均为 AI前钱 原创,转载请注明出处和附带本文链接。

分享到:

发表评论

评论列表
公众号二维码

微信公众号